Howdy everyone,
I have noticed that sometimes when stopping at a stop light my front breaks will squeel. I only have 4200 miles on the car. Anyone else have this problem or is this normal brake noise? any opinions on if I should I take it to the dealer to have it checked out? Thanks a bunch, Frank[?] |
|
|||
![]()
I would have it checked out by the dealer's. Think the brakes have a warranty of 1 year/12,000 miles. So any problems need to be taken care of before that time or you may end up paying. I only notice a squeeking noise in the mornings because of the rust forming overnite on the rotors. But after a few miles, all is quiet.
